自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(13)
  • 资源 (1)
  • 收藏
  • 关注

原创 mysql8.0千万数据量性能优化指南(四):MySQL数据库设计

这篇博客介绍了MySQL中的数据类型及其选择的重要性,包括整数、实数、字符串和日期类型。详细讲解了表分区的几种方法,如水平分区和哈希分区,以及视图、存储过程、触发器的使用。最后,还涵盖了数据库的备份和恢复,以及用户和权限管理的基本知识。

2024-05-28 08:48:06 1053

原创 mysql8.0千万数据量性能优化指南(三):查询优化

本文介绍了 MySQL 8.0 查询优化方法,包括合并统计、使用近似值和缓存优化 COUNT() 函数,覆盖索引优化分页查询,确保 JOIN 操作的连接列有索引,以及避免不必要的数据请求和分解复杂查询,提升大规模数据处理性能。

2024-05-20 15:19:02 671 1

原创 mysql8.0千万数据量性能优化指南(二):创建高性能索引

在处理大规模数据时,索引的选择和优化对MySQL数据库性能至关重要。本文基于InnoDB引擎,介绍了MySQL 8.0中常用的索引类型(如主键索引和非主键索引),并提供了一系列优化索引的方法,包括覆盖索引、最左前缀原则和索引下推等。

2024-05-16 23:12:49 908 1

原创 mysql8.0千万数据量性能优化指南(一):如何快速插入千万条测试数据

本文介绍了在MySQL 8.0中快速插入千万条测试数据的三种方法,并对其性能进行了比较。这三种方法分别是:存储过程、批量插入和使用LOAD DATA语句。存储过程适用于小规模数据插入,但扩展性和性能较差;批量插入通过合并多个插入语句,提高了中等规模数据插入的效率;LOAD DATA语句则是处理大数据量插入的最佳选择,速度最快。通过对比和分析,读者可以根据实际需求选择最合适的插入方法,以优化MySQL数据库的插入性能。

2024-05-16 10:32:14 250

原创 Windows gmssl生成SM2自签证书 + java bc库签名验签

Windows gmssl生成SM2证书 + java bc库签名验签。

2022-09-07 09:47:03 4379 1

原创 学习笔记——Idea搭建第一个MyBatis项目

一、简介不班门弄斧了,直接放上mybatis的文档。链接:https://mybatis.org/mybatis-3/zh/index.html或直接点击MyBatis3中文文档 二、环境Idea 2017.3JDK 1.8maven 3.3.9MySql 8.0.15三、start!1.新建一个maven项目无脑next即可。2.创建一个数据库新建一个mybatis...

2020-12-04 15:42:10 356

原创 jdk动态代理—如何执行到invoke方法

先写一个动态代理demo。接口:public interface Inter { void test();}目标类,即需要被代理的类:/** * 要被代理的类 */public class InterImpl implements Inter { @Override public void test() { System.out.println("======执行了test方法======"); }}写一个类生成代理对象:/** *

2020-12-04 15:06:48 1829 5

原创 搭建bt服务器错误urlopen error [Errno 113] No route to host

自己搭建BT服务器,在服务器发布种子时遇到如下错误:如果这两个错误同时出现,很可能是制作种子文件时的ip与现ip不同,重新制作种子文件即可。只有这个错误时,删除metainfo和resume文件夹即可。...

2020-04-15 19:06:50 1717

原创 解决QT导出的exe无法读取数据库

把QT安装目录下的plugins\sqldrivers文件夹直接复制到与exe同级目录下即可

2020-04-13 11:53:07 549 1

原创 安装fabric二进制文件下载速度慢

安装fabric Samples, Binaries和Docker Images官方文档:https://hyperledger-fabric.readthedocs.io/en/release-1.4/install.html如果下载最新版本,直接运行:curl -sSL http://bit.ly/2ysbOFE | bash -s下载特定版本,如Fabric1.4.4,Fabric...

2020-01-27 18:08:24 3734 2

原创 fabric first-network学习笔记

cd fabric-samples/first-network./byfn.sh generate运行完成后,fabric-samples\first-network中多了名叫crypto-config的文件夹。生成初始区块../bin/cryptogen generate --config=./crypto-config.yamlexport FABRIC_CFG_PATH=$PW...

2020-01-26 16:36:43 459

原创 C语言基姆拉尔森计算公式已知日期求星期几

基姆拉尔森计算公式公式如下:W= (d+2m+3(m+1)/5+y+y/4-y/100+y/400+1)%7在公式中d表示日期中的日数,m表示月份数,y表示年数。注意:在公式中有个与其他公式不同的地方:把一月和二月看成是上一年的十三月和十四月,例:如果是2004-1-10则换算成:2003-13-10来代入公式计算。代码#include <stdio.h>#includ...

2019-01-13 20:24:15 564

原创 C语言自带快速排序函数qsort()

qsort基本格式功 能: 使用快速排序例程进行排序头文件:stdlib.hvoid qsort(void*base, size_t num, size_t width, int(__cdecl*compare)(const void*,const void*) )各参数:1 数组名(待排序数组首地址 )2 数组中待排序元素数量3 各元素的占用空间...

2019-01-13 00:25:11 1369

数据结构演示c_demo.zip

数据结构演示动画+数据结构PPT 帮助更好的理解数据结构

2019-06-27

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除